About the role
This person is intricately involved in operations of the Fund Accounting and Data Accounting analysis functions and will help establish work priorities, delegate projects/assignments, monitor progress and communicate results.
Responsibilities
- Review the daily work prepared by their associates including corporate action processing, pricing downloads, security master file setup, and other data
- Proficient with the various software programs which help facilitate the processing and distribution of data
- Aid with various fund accounting systems/software to facilitate maintenance, new release testing, upgrades, service packs, and/or daily, weekly, and monthly downloads
- Resolve complex and escalated issues and become actively involved in fund accounting reports, tasks, and/or projects as needed
- Review daily fund accounting reports for client portfolios, the daily cash forecast reports, and monthly reporting packages (which includes data extraction and transmission to clients)
- Assist with the coordination of fund audits, perform daily pricing reviews for client portfolios, and complete signoffs
- Oversee the daily work and reporting for complex/high maintenance client(s) and may assist other internal teams with specialized client reporting
- Provide training and development to their teams and offer performance evaluations and career development guidance
- Manage client expectations, develop client solutions, and ensure the work performed meets or exceeds contract and service level obligations

Company Information
SS&C is a leading financial services and healthcare technology company based on revenue, headquartered in Windsor, Connecticut, with 27,000+ employees in 35 countries. SS&C supports complex financial and health care operations through proprietary technology and deep industry expertise, helping clients manage data, automate processes, and scale their businesses with confidence.
